Artificial intelligence is rapidly changing how media planners approach campaign strategy. From predictive analytics to automated optimization, AI tools are enabling more precise targeting, better budget allocation, and improved ROI measurement.

The Evolution of Media Planning

Media planning has traditionally been a labor-intensive process, requiring extensive market research, audience analysis, and manual optimization. Planners would spend weeks gathering data, analyzing trends, and making educated guesses about the best channels and tactics for reaching target audiences.

With the advent of AI, this process has been transformed. Machine learning algorithms can now process vast amounts of data in seconds, identifying patterns and insights that would be impossible for humans to detect. This has led to more efficient planning processes and more effective campaigns.

Key AI Applications in Media Planning

1. Audience Segmentation and Targeting

AI excels at identifying meaningful audience segments based on behavior, preferences, and demographics. Rather than relying on broad demographic categories, AI can create micro-segments based on thousands of data points, enabling hyper-targeted campaigns that resonate with specific audience groups.

For example, an AI system might identify that a subset of your target audience is particularly responsive to video content on weekday evenings, while another segment engages more with text-based content on weekend mornings. This level of granularity allows for much more precise targeting and messaging.

2. Budget Allocation and Optimization

One of the most powerful applications of AI in media planning is dynamic budget allocation. AI systems can continuously analyze campaign performance across channels and automatically adjust spending to maximize ROI.

These systems can detect early signals of campaign success or failure and reallocate resources accordingly, often before human planners would notice the trends. This real-time optimization ensures that marketing budgets are always being used as efficiently as possible.

3. Predictive Analytics

AI's predictive capabilities allow media planners to forecast campaign outcomes with unprecedented accuracy. By analyzing historical data and current market conditions, AI can predict how different audience segments will respond to various creative approaches and media placements.

This predictive power enables planners to test different scenarios virtually before committing real budget, significantly reducing the risk of campaign failure and improving overall performance.

Real-World Success Stories

A major retail brand recently implemented an AI-driven media planning system that increased their ROAS (Return on Ad Spend) by 35% while reducing planning time by 60%. The system identified several underperforming channels that human planners had overlooked and discovered new audience segments that showed high conversion potential.

Similarly, a telecommunications company used AI to optimize their media mix, resulting in a 28% increase in new customer acquisitions while maintaining the same overall budget. The AI system recommended a significant shift from traditional TV advertising to a combination of connected TV and digital audio, which proved much more effective at reaching their target demographic.

The Future of AI in Media Planning

As AI technology continues to evolve, we can expect even more sophisticated applications in media planning. Some emerging trends include:

  • Cross-channel attribution modeling: AI will provide increasingly accurate views of how different channels contribute to conversions, enabling more effective budget allocation.
  • Creative optimization: AI will not only determine where to place ads but will also provide insights into which creative approaches will resonate most with specific audience segments.
  • Contextual relevance: Advanced AI will better understand the context in which ads appear, ensuring brand safety and maximizing relevance.
  • Voice and visual search optimization: As search behaviors evolve, AI will help planners optimize for these new channels.

Getting Started with AI-Powered Media Planning

For organizations looking to leverage AI in their media planning processes, here are some recommended steps:

  1. Audit your data: AI systems require quality data to function effectively. Ensure you have clean, comprehensive data on past campaigns, audience behaviors, and conversions.
  2. Start small: Begin by implementing AI in one aspect of your media planning, such as audience segmentation or budget optimization, before expanding to a comprehensive AI-driven approach.
  3. Combine AI with human expertise: The most successful implementations of AI in media planning combine algorithmic intelligence with human strategic thinking and creativity.
  4. Continuously test and learn: AI systems improve over time as they gather more data. Implement a rigorous testing framework to continuously refine your approach.
